DR.NTRUHS M Sc Nursing Entrance Exam Previous Paper 2014

Q.1 The union of ovum and sperm is known as
1) Folification
2) Fertilization
3) Placentation
4) Ovulation
Answer:2
Q.2 The nurse makes that the diet consumed by PEM child is rich in
1) Protein, carbohydrates and vitamins
2) Micro nutrient
3) Water soluble vitamins
4) Fats and vitamins
Answer:1
Q.3 The position of patient during immediate postoperative period of tonsillectomy surgery is
1) Sim’s position
2) Prone position
3) Lateral position
4) Rose position
Answer:3
Q.4 The study of distribution and determinants of the disease is called
1) Epidemiology
2) Entomology
3) Pathology
4) Community
Answer:1
Q.5 The scientific method of study of human population is
1) Anthropology
2) Demography
3) Ecology
4) Sociology
Answer:2
Q.6 Which NSAID undergoes enterohepatic circulation?
1) Phenylbutaxone
2) Aspirin
3) Ibuprofen
4) Piroxicam
Answer:1
Q.7 Ortolani is a test performed to find out
1) Fractures
2) Bone injuries
3) Club foot M Sc Nursing
4) Congenital hip dislocation
Answer:4
Q.8 The nurse interprets a positive Homans sign as
1) Deep venous thrombosis
2) Pulmonary embolism
3) Pneumothorax
4) Stroke
Answer:1
Q.9 Glycosuria occurs when Plasma glucose level exceeds
1) 120–140mg/dl
2) 100-120mg/dl
3) 130-150mg/dl
4) 160-180mg/dl
Answer:4
Q.10 Virulence of a disease is indicated by
1) Proportional mortality rate
2) Specific morality rate
3) Case fatality ratio
4) Morbidity rate
Answer:2
Q.11 All the following are the responsibilities of nurse for a patient with heart failure, except
1) Maintain intake outpatient chart
2) Auscultate lung sounds M Sc Nursing
3) Weight the patient daily
4) Maintain intracranial pressure
Answer:4
Q.12 Which test is used to find out the early stage of leprosy
1) Lepromine test
2) Histamine test
3) Morphological index
4) Bacterial index
Answer:1
Q.13 The polyvalent type of vaccines are prepared from
1) More strains of same species
2) Single species
3) More strains of different species
4) Single organism
Answer:1
Q.14 Researchers must be content to say that hypothesis is
1) Probably true
2) Type I error
3) Type II error
4) Level of significance
Answer:1

Q.15 The coordination between the fundal contraction and cervical dilatation is called
1) Softening of the uterus
2) Hypertrophy
3) Increased vascularity
4) Polarity of uterus
Answer:4
Q.16 The system of storage and transport of vaccine at low temperature is called
1) Cold chain system
2) Vaccine chain system
3) Vaccine carrier
4) Ice linked refrigerate
Answer:1
Q.17 The saturation level of oxygen in the blood can be assessed by using
1) Spirometer
2) Pulse oximetry
3) Tonometer
4) Cardiac monitor
Answer:2

Q.18 Function of ciliated epithelium is
1) Protection
2) Secretion
3) Moves mucus and other substances
4) Immune response
Answer:3
Q.19 Increase in the size of the muscle of the arm in a weight lifter is an example of
1) Hyperplasia
2) Hypertrophy
3) Metaplasia
4) Dysplasia
Answer:2
Q.20 Pulse oximeter is a non invasive method to assess the level of
1) Arterial oxygenation
2) Fraction of inspired O2
3) O2 intake
4) Stoke volume
Answer:1

Q.21 Kernicterus occurs once the bilirubin crosses
1) 15 mg/dl
2) 20 mg/dl
3) 25 mg/dl
4) 30 mg/dl
Answer:2
Q.22 The volume of air that moves in and out of lungs with each respiration is
1) Tidal volume
2) Minute volume
3) lung capacity M Sc Nursing
4) Lung reserve
Answer:1
Q.23 Core body temperature is
1) Skin temperature
2) Axilla temperature
3) Rectal temperature
4) Oral temperature
Answer:3
Q.24 Anatomical description of the imaginary vertical plane passing longitudinal through the body from front to back, dividing it right and left halves is called as
1) Coronal plane
2) Sagittal plane
3) Median plane
4) Horizontal plane
Answer:3
Q.25 In which position, the nurse has to keep a patient with breathing difficulty
1) Sim’s position
2) Prone position
3) Supine position
4) Fowler’s position
Answer:4
Q.26 Osteoporosis may occur after
1) Oophrectomy
2) Colectomy
3) Nephrectomy
4) Amputation
Answer:1
Q.27 The stages of death and dying include
1) Powerlessness
2) Bargaining
3) Role strain
4) Ethical dilemma
Answer:2
